With the proper care, an asphalt driveway can last up to 20 years. One way to ensure it stays looking like new is with asphalt sealing. In fact, this technique offers a host of benefits and should be done once every three years. Here are three more reasons it’s important to schedule this service.

3 Benefits of Asphalt Sealing

1. Helps Resist Fading

Fading is caused by sun and rain or snow oxidation and makes your driveway look old and worn out, affecting the aesthetic of your home. Worse still, when the sun fades your driveway, it also dries it out, which can make the asphalt brittle under heavy weight, like when you pull your car in and out of the driveway. Brittle asphalt will crumble, but sealing it on a regular basis will prevent this issue.

2. Prevents Cracking

asphalt sealingAge and the elements break down an asphalt driveway, resulting in loose chunks and cracking. Cracks make the surface vulnerable to water, especially during the winter, when water tends to freeze and thaw in cycles. This process will worsen cracks and could compromise the entire driveway. Sealing will make it tougher for cracks to form.

3. Makes It Easier to Clean

Household solvents, cleaners, and oils can stain asphalt if it’s not properly sealed. When the pores are sealed off, though, it’s more difficult for liquids to penetrate the surface. As a result, oil and other fluids are easier to wipe off and clean before they soak in and weaken and stain the driveway.
